Are you tired of setting New Year's resolutions that never stick? It’s time to stop planning for "productivity" and start preparing for fulfilment. In our final Article and Design gathering of 2025, we took a deep dive into Jesse Itzler’s "Best Year" System. As designers and thinkers, we often get bogged down in the "work" of life—this session was about reclaiming our time and designing a 2026 that is fulfilling, challenging, and intentional. In this session, our members discussed: Getting Light: How we as creatives can clear digital clutter and achieve "Communication Zero" to make room for new ideas. The 2025 Audit: Reviewing our "Highlight Reels" and sending handwritten notes to those who inspired our work this year. Our 2026 Misogi: Each member shared the one monumental, limit-pushing challenge they are putting on the calendar. Whether you're an Article and Design member who missed the meet-up or a fellow creator looking for a framework to reset, this breakdown of the 3-step system will help you start 2026 with clarity and purpose.
